BAPTIST UNION INCORPORATION ACT 1919 - SECT 3
Power to purchase etc
3 Power to purchase etc
(1) The corporation shall have power to purchase, acquire and hold lands and
any interest therein and also to sell, mortgage, lease, or otherwise dispose
of the said lands or any interest therein, and all lands, tenements,
hereditaments, and other property, real or personal, now belonging to the said
association under the said rules and by-laws or vested in trustees for the
said association or any committee thereof or for the general purposes of the
said denomination shall on the passing of this Act be vested in and become the
property of the corporation subject to any trusts, special or otherwise, and
to all charges and claims and demands in anywise affecting the same.
(2) The
corporation has, and shall be deemed always to have had, power to acquire,
purchase, exchange, hire, sell, mortgage, lease, hold and dispose of, and
otherwise deal with, personal property.
(3) The corporation may do and suffer
all things that bodies corporate generally may, by law, do and suffer and that
are necessary for or incidental to the purposes for which it is constituted.
